Maggie’s reluctance to use the soft bed initially appeared behavioral.

The shelter provided a low mattress with no raised sides. Maggie smelled it, stretched her neck toward the surface, and immediately stepped backward.

When staff placed food in the middle, she refused to retrieve it.

She slept on the concrete directly beside the bed.

Several explanations were possible. Maggie may never have encountered that type of surface. A previous bed may have been associated with confinement, punishment, or pain.

The mattress could also have felt unstable beneath weak hind legs. Soft surfaces require small balance adjustments that can be difficult for a dog with nerve compression.

The team did not invent a specific traumatic history.

There was no verified information showing that Maggie had been beaten, kept in a crate, or punished for using furniture.

What they could observe was that the bed caused avoidance, and forcing her onto it increased fear.

The veterinarian recommended advanced imaging and consultation with a neurologist.

Ordinary X-rays show bones well but cannot fully display the spinal cord, nerve roots, discs, and other soft tissues.

A CT scan and MRI were discussed. The neurologist selected imaging based on the location of Maggie’s signs and the information needed for surgical planning.

Maggie underwent MRI under general anesthesia after bloodwork and cardiopulmonary evaluation.

Her anesthesia plan accounted for fear, pain, body condition, and the need to position her safely.

The imaging revealed degenerative lumbosacral stenosis, sometimes called cauda equina syndrome.

The disc and surrounding tissues near the base of the spine had changed and narrowed the space available for important nerve roots.

Arthritic bone and thickened supporting structures added to the compression.

These nerves help control movement and sensation in the hind legs, tail function, and aspects of bladder and bowel control.

Dogs with lumbosacral disease may show pain when rising, reluctance to jump or climb, hind-leg weakness, toe dragging, difficulty lifting the tail, altered posture, or trouble controlling elimination.

The severity varies.

Maggie still had deep sensation and could walk, which were favorable signs. However, her weakness was progressing, and she had begun showing difficulty maintaining a normal squat.

The neurologist found no evidence of a spinal tumor on the imaging. No recent fracture was present.

The changes appeared chronic and degenerative rather than caused by one new injury.

Conservative treatment was considered.

Some dogs with milder signs improve with restricted activity, medication, weight management, and rehabilitation.

Maggie had already received pain treatment and controlled movement. Her neurological deficits continued progressing.

The degree of compression and risk to bladder function made surgery the recommended option.

The planned procedure would remove part of the bone and tissue pressing on the nerves. The goal was decompression, not replacement of damaged nerves.

Even after pressure is relieved, nerves need time to recover. Tissue compressed for a long period may not return completely to normal.

Risks included infection, bleeding, anesthesia complications, continued pain, scar formation, instability, worsening weakness, loss of bladder control, or failure to improve.

The rescue organization reviewed the diagnosis, prognosis, cost, aftercare, and Maggie’s overall welfare.

Surgery offered the best chance of preserving independent movement and preventing further deterioration.

Underwater treadmill therapy was considered after the incision had fully healed.

Water can reduce weight-bearing pressure while allowing controlled leg movement, but not every fearful dog tolerates the equipment.

Maggie was introduced to the empty treadmill first.

She entered with support and left immediately.

During later sessions, a small amount of water was added slowly. Maggie remained tense but accepted food.

The session ended before panic.

Water depth and duration increased gradually over several visits.

Maggie eventually walked for several minutes with the therapist supporting her.

Her right leg moved more consistently in the water.

The therapy remained one component of rehabilitation, not a guaranteed cure.

Maggie’s long-term medical needs include spinal monitoring, weight management, controlled exercise, arthritis care, and prompt evaluation of neurological changes.

Warning signs include worsening toe dragging, inability to stand, sudden severe pain, loss of tail movement, urinary or fecal accidents unrelated to access, inability to empty the bladder, or reduced sensation in the feet.

Any rapid deterioration requires veterinary attention.

Scar tissue or continued degeneration could cause future compression.

Some dogs require additional imaging or another procedure. Others maintain good function with rehabilitation and medical support.

Maggie’s progress will be assessed over months rather than days.
